looks like Nero INCD is busted either by XP SP1 or Office SP2. InCd filing, ie saving & copying, within XP is ok, but not saving to an InCd disk via Word_SP2.
The Word error talks about file permissions, but i havn't changed anything. Trouble is i didn't test InCd file-saving via Word after Office_SP2 & before XP_SP1. Also, not possible to format a blank CDRW via InCd tray icon so I guess its XP_SP1 to blame, ina manner of speaking, not Word_SP2. |
i would recommend installing sp1 only as soon as windows xp is installed. otherwise, installing service packs in the middle of the stage, would cause errors. it happened when i used windows 2000 professional. i was using it for a while. and then sp2 came out. after i install it, the system became unstable. i think it is cos a large number of system files gets updated and the other software is not ready for it. once install sp2 soon after installing windows 2000, and then install all the other rest of the software, everything seemed be all right :)
